Pakistani pop star Atif Aslam has finally spoken about the decade‑long ban that prevented him from performing in India, prompting fans to stream his music through VPNs.

Pakistani singer Atif Aslam, famed for chart‑topping hits, has for the first time addressed the 10‑year ban that barred him from performing in India. The singer, who has not publicly commented on the restriction until now, revealed that the ban was imposed amid heightened political tensions between the two nations.

In an interview reported by NDTV, Aslam expressed his disappointment at being unable to connect with Indian audiences for a decade, but also conveyed optimism that the situation could change in the future. He thanked fans for their unwavering support.

Indian listeners, who have been unable to legally stream his music, have resorted to VPN services to access his songs. The singer’s comments have reignited discussions about easing cultural restrictions.

While the ban remains in effect, Aslam’s statement may open the door for a potential relaxation of the policy, allowing him to perform and engage with fans in India once again.
